简体中文简体中文
EnglishEnglish
简体中文简体中文

深入解析电影源码:PHP在电影网站开发中的应用与

2025-01-07 16:17:51

随着互联网的快速发展,电影行业也迎来了前所未有的繁荣。众多电影爱好者纷纷涌入线上平台,享受着便捷的观影体验。在这个过程中,电影网站作为连接观众与电影资源的桥梁,其重要性不言而喻。而PHP作为一种广泛应用于网站开发的编程语言,也在电影源码中扮演着重要角色。本文将深入解析电影源码中的PHP应用,探讨其在电影网站开发中的实现与优势。

一、PHP在电影源码中的作用

1.数据库连接与操作

电影网站需要存储大量的电影信息,如电影名称、导演、演员、上映时间等。PHP通过MySQL数据库连接,实现对电影数据的增删改查操作。这使得电影网站能够快速、高效地管理电影资源。

2.用户认证与权限管理

电影网站需要为用户提供登录、注册、评论等功能。PHP通过验证用户名、密码等信息,实现用户认证。同时,根据用户角色分配不同的权限,确保网站安全稳定运行。

3.电影搜索与推荐

PHP在电影源码中负责实现电影搜索功能,用户可以根据关键词、导演、演员等条件搜索电影。此外,PHP还可以根据用户观看记录、评分等数据,为用户推荐相似的电影,提高用户体验。

4.视频播放与广告投放

电影网站需要提供视频播放功能,PHP通过调用视频播放器API,实现视频的在线播放。同时,PHP还可以根据用户行为和广告位信息,实现精准的广告投放,为网站带来收益。

二、电影源码PHP实现方式

1.数据库设计

在电影源码中,PHP首先需要设计合理的数据库结构。通常包括电影表、用户表、评论表、广告位表等。通过合理的设计,确保数据存储的完整性和查询的效率。

2.数据库连接

PHP通过mysqli或PDO等数据库连接库,实现与MySQL数据库的连接。在连接过程中,需要设置合适的数据库连接参数,如数据库地址、用户名、密码等。

3.数据操作

PHP通过执行SQL语句,实现对电影数据的增删改查操作。在编写SQL语句时,需要注意SQL注入等安全问题,确保数据操作的安全性。

4.用户认证与权限管理

PHP通过验证用户名、密码等信息,实现用户认证。同时,根据用户角色分配不同的权限,确保网站安全稳定运行。

5.电影搜索与推荐

PHP通过编写搜索算法,实现电影搜索功能。在推荐算法方面,可以采用协同过滤、基于内容的推荐等方法,提高推荐效果。

6.视频播放与广告投放

PHP通过调用视频播放器API,实现视频的在线播放。在广告投放方面,可以根据用户行为和广告位信息,实现精准的广告投放。

三、PHP在电影源码开发中的优势

1.开源免费

PHP是一种开源免费的编程语言,降低了电影网站开发的成本。

2.易学易用

PHP语法简洁,易于学习和掌握,使得开发人员能够快速上手。

3.高效稳定

PHP拥有丰富的库和框架,如ThinkPHP、Laravel等,提高了开发效率。同时,PHP运行稳定,保证了电影网站的正常运行。

4.良好的社区支持

PHP拥有庞大的开发者社区,为开发者提供丰富的技术支持和交流平台。

总之,PHP在电影源码开发中发挥着重要作用。通过深入解析电影源码中的PHP应用,我们可以更好地理解其在电影网站开发中的实现与优势。在未来的电影网站开发中,PHP将继续发挥其独特的价值。